Category: Application Integration
Service: Amazon AppFlow
Answer:
Amazon AppFlow allows users to create data flows to move data between different systems. The key components of an AppFlow workflow are:
Sources: Sources are where the data originates from. They can be cloud-based services like Salesforce, Marketo, or Zendesk, or on-premises data sources like databases or file systems.
Destinations: Destinations are the target systems where data will be moved to. They can also be cloud-based services or on-premises data sources.
Connectors: Connectors provide the means to connect to the sources and destinations. Amazon AppFlow provides a number of pre-built connectors that make it easy to connect to common sources and destinations.
Flows: Flows are the core of the AppFlow workflow. Flows specify the source, destination, and any necessary transformations required to move data from the source to the destination.
Data transformations: AppFlow provides a number of built-in transformations to map and transform data between different systems. Users can also create their own custom transformations using AWS Lambda functions.
Triggers: Triggers are used to initiate the flow of data between the source and destination. AppFlow provides a number of trigger types, such as time-based triggers or triggers based on changes to the source data.
Monitoring and Logging: AppFlow provides monitoring and logging capabilities to track the progress of data flows and identify any errors or issues.
All of these components work together to create a data flow that moves data from a source system to a destination system, with any necessary transformations in between.
Get Cloud Computing Course here